Indianapolis, IN, housed the site of an abandoned iron foundry sitting vacant for 50 years. WebJun 5, 2024 · Increase Local Tax Revenue: A study of 48 brownfields sites found that an estimated $29 million to $97 million in additional local tax revenue was generated in a single year after cleanup. This is two to seven times more than the $12.4 million EPA contributed to the cleanup of these sites.
